Can Reflection Improve Mental Health And Wellness?
Millions of individuals around the world practice reflection. It can take lots of types, including breathing deeply, repeating a concept or utilizing rhythmic movement like yoga exercise, tai chi and qigong.


While it's not a remedy for psychological health disorders, meditation can enhance state of mind and lower tension. It may likewise protect against stress and anxiety from triggering anxiety or stress and anxiety episodes.

Stress and anxiety Reduction
Many people use meditation to minimize stress and anxiety, which is an usual cause of health problems. As a matter of fact, a 2015 meta-analysis discovered that reflection lowers physical pens of stress like cortisol and heart rate in diverse adult medical populaces.

Reflection functions to loosen up the mind and body by triggering the relaxation reaction. This restores your inner balance, assisting you shake off the impacts of everyday anxiety and construct psychological strength to take care of stressful situations.

However, meditation does not simply help you manage stress, it teaches you to handle negative thoughts and emotions by observing them without judgment. For example, if you're feeling anxious or worried during a meditation session, you can simply notice these thoughts and return your focus to deep breathing.

The even more you technique, the far better you come to be at releasing purposeless ideas and feelings. However meditation isn't a replacement for therapy, and it may intensify some medical conditions in certain patients. So it is essential to speak with your health care expert before trying reflection.

Much better Rest
It's simple to think about a long order of business or concerns as you attempt to go to sleep at night, but regular meditation can help you get a far better evening's rest. This is partly due to the fact that reflection lowers stress and anxiety degrees, however it may additionally enhance melatonin degrees and boost the rate at which you go to sleep.

During meditation, you may concentrate on your breathing or a repeated phrase or word. You should be able to see any kind of ideas that turn up and let them go without judgement. If you find it hard to quit believing, it's a great idea to start with short sessions and progressively develop your capability to meditate for longer periods of time.

There are many different ways to practice meditation and it is very important to discover one that works for you. To begin, being in a peaceful location, preferably with no disturbances. Focus on your breathing and try to relax your body-- beginning with the face, then moving to the shoulders, back, abdominal area, hips, legs and feet.

Minimized Anxiety
Stress is an usual reason for anxiety and reflection has been shown to lower physiological markers of stress and anxiety, such as heart rate. It can also boost dealing with anxiety and help reduce signs and symptoms of stress-related health and wellness conditions, such as short-tempered bowel disorder (IBS), trauma (PTSD) and fibromyalgia.

Throughout meditation, you concentrate on your breath and discover any ideas that occur. The objective is not to press away or block out adverse thoughts, yet to observe them and after that delicately return your interest to your breathing. This helps you identify that unfavorable or stressful sensations don't need to define you.

Some researches reveal that meditation modifications specific mind regions related to depression. Nonetheless, the research study is restricted as it is tough to perform RCTs with meditation as a result of the nature of the therapy, which calls for energetic participation and everyday practice from the individual. Additionally, sugar pill effects might play a role. Consequently, more study with different sorts of meditation and a bigger sample dimension is required to verify the advantages.

Better State of mind
Stress and stress and anxiety are major triggers for anxiety, and though psychiatric therapy and antidepressants are typically the first-line therapy choices, lots of patients discover that reflection is useful too. Meditation can assist improve mood by modifying the way your mind mindfulness therapy replies to tension and anxiousness.

Specifically, it can minimize the activity in one of the vital areas that triggers clinical depression: the medial prefrontal cortex (mPFC). The mPFC is connected to the "me facility" in your brain, which gets developed over negative emotions and ideas. It additionally sends signals to the amygdala, or concern facility, which then releases cortisol in action to a perceived risk or threat.

When you meditate, you focus on your breath or the audios around you to remove on your own from demanding thoughts and feelings. Regardless of its many benefits, meditation is hard and it takes time to turn into a behavior. Keep exercising until you discover a method that matches you. Over time, the advantages you really feel can be tremendous.
